  • 3 Delicious Barbados Foods You Must Try
    By: Denise McCarthy | - Three of the tasty Barbados foods that are popular among locals and tourists are macaroni pie, fried flying fish, and fish cakes.

    Bajan Macaroni Pie

    Macaroni pie in Barbados is a local dish made of macaroni, butter, breadcrumbs, cheddar cheese, milk, mustard, white pepper, onion powder, red or cayenne pepper, eggs and salt.   • Prepare And Cook Macaroni.
    By: John Ugoshowa | - Macaroni is a product of wheat prepared from a hard, clean, glutenous grain. The grain is ground into a meal called semolina, from which the bran is excluded. This is made into a tasty dough by mixing with hot water in the proportion of two thirds semolina to one third water. The dough after being thoroughly mixed is put into a shallow vat and kneaded and rolled by machinery.
